Linux磁盘管理,从基础到实践的全面解析
Linux磁盘管理全面解析,从基础到实践。Linux系统提供了多种磁盘管理工具,如fdisk、lsblk等,用于查看、分区、格式化等操作。通过这些工具,用户可以有效地管理磁盘空间,提高系统性能。实践中的磁盘管理还需注意备份、监控和故障排除等环节,确保系统稳定运行。全面掌握Linux磁盘管理,对于提升系统运维效率具有重要意义。
在Linux系统中,磁盘管理是系统管理的重要一环,无论是服务器还是个人电脑,磁盘的合理配置和高效使用都是保证系统稳定运行的关键,本文将详细介绍Linux磁盘管理的基础知识、常用工具以及实践操作,帮助读者全面掌握Linux磁盘管理的技巧。
Linux磁盘管理基础知识
1、磁盘分区与文件系统
Linux系统中的磁盘管理首先涉及到磁盘分区和文件系统的概念,磁盘分区是将物理硬盘划分为若干个逻辑区域,每个区域可以独立进行格式化和挂载,而文件系统则是操作系统用于组织和管理磁盘空间的一种方式,不同的文件系统具有不同的特性和适用场景。
2、磁盘类型与标识
Linux系统中的磁盘类型包括硬盘、固态硬盘(SSD)、USB移动硬盘等,每个磁盘在系统中都有一个唯一的标识符,即设备文件名,通过设备文件名,我们可以轻松地识别和管理系统中的每个磁盘。
Linux磁盘管理常用工具
1、fdisk命令
fdisk是Linux系统中用于磁盘分区的常用工具,通过fdisk命令,我们可以查看系统中的磁盘分区情况、创建新的分区、删除或调整分区大小等。
2、df命令
df命令用于查看文件系统的磁盘空间使用情况,通过df命令,我们可以了解每个文件系统所占用的空间大小、已用空间和可用空间等信息。
3、du命令
du命令用于查看文件和目录的磁盘使用情况,通过du命令,我们可以了解某个文件或目录所占用的磁盘空间大小,从而帮助我们更好地管理文件和目录的存储空间。
4、mount命令与umount命令
mount命令用于挂载文件系统到Linux系统中,而umount命令则用于卸载已挂载的文件系统,这两个命令在Linux磁盘管理中具有重要作用。
Linux磁盘管理实践操作
1、查看磁盘分区情况
使用fdisk -l命令可以查看系统中的所有磁盘及其分区情况,通过该命令,我们可以了解每个磁盘的设备文件名、分区类型、大小等信息。
2、创建新的分区
使用fdisk命令可以创建新的分区,选择要创建分区的磁盘,然后创建新的分区并设置分区类型和大小,创建完分区后,需要使用mkfs命令格式化新分区,以便在Linux系统中使用。
3、挂载文件系统
创建完分区并格式化后,需要将文件系统挂载到Linux系统中才能使用,使用mount命令可以挂载文件系统,指定挂载点和文件系统类型等参数,挂载完成后,我们就可以在Linux系统中访问该文件系统的文件和目录了。
4、管理文件和目录的存储空间
通过du和df命令,我们可以管理文件和目录的存储空间,du命令可以帮助我们了解某个文件或目录所占用的磁盘空间大小,从而帮助我们优化存储空间的使用,而df命令则可以让我们了解每个文件系统的空间使用情况,帮助我们及时发现并解决磁盘空间不足的问题。
5、卸载已挂载的文件系统
当需要卸载已挂载的文件系统时,可以使用umount命令,在卸载文件系统之前,需要确保该文件系统上没有正在运行的进程或服务,否则可能会导致卸载失败或数据丢失等问题。
本文详细介绍了Linux磁盘管理的基础知识、常用工具以及实践操作,通过掌握这些知识和技能,我们可以更好地管理Linux系统中的磁盘空间,保证系统的稳定运行和数据的安全存储,在实际应用中,我们需要根据具体的需求和场景选择合适的工具和方法进行磁盘管理,以达到最佳的管理效果。